Cranberry White Chocolate Loaf Cake
Ingredients:
1 cup all pur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
¼ teaspoon salt
¼ cup sugar
1 egg
¼ cup sour cream
4 tablespoons milk
5 tablespoons butter melted and divided
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 cup chopped fresh cranberries (can use frozen)
½ cup white chocolate chips
Sugar for coating
Directions:
Preheat the oven to 350 °F.
In a bowl mix together your dry ingredients and stir to combine.
Add your egg, sour cream, milk, 1 tablespoon butter, and vanilla extract and stir until just combined.
Fold in your cranberries and white chocolate chips.
Spray your loaf pan with non-stick cooking spray and pipe or spoon your donut batter into wells.
Bake for about 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Remove your loaf pan from the oven and invert onto a cooling rack, let cool until able to handle.
Brush the top of the loaf pan with remaining melted butter and sprinkle on sugar
